Calculate Log Base 289 of 90

To solve the equation log 289 (90)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 90, a = 289:
    log 289 (90) = log(90) / log(289)
  3. Evaluate the term:
    log(90) / log(289)
    = 1.39794000867204 / 1.92427928606188
    = 0.79411768968447
    = Logarithm of 90 with base 289
